[software development] linuxQQ都可以软件自动更新了
Tofloor
poster avatar
随机数
deepin
2024-11-19 09:41
Author

今早发现QQ提示更新,点击重启更新后,版本真的更新了。这个说明linuxQQ已经实现了软件自动更新了,跟windows下软件自动更新的路子是一样一样的了。不知有没有坛友也发现有这个现象。

Reply Favorite View the author
All Replies
随机数
deepin
2024-11-19 09:56
#1

截图_选择区域_20241119095357.jpg
截图_deepin-home-appstore-client_20241119095330.jpg
更新后,之前通过应用商店安装的及通过商店更新的QQ的info信息中,版本还是跟11月15日商店上的版本一样。而QQ自身的版本已经变化。

截图_gvim_20241119095245.jpg

Reply View the author
sammy-621
deepin
2024-11-19 10:04
#2

确实是这样。给QQ团队点赞

Reply View the author
忘记、过去
deepin
2024-11-19 10:32
#3

这个功能第一版 QQNT 就有吧?当时的自动更新在用户主目录下又重新下载了一份新版本,启动的时候会指向新版本启动;实际上通过 dpkg 查询软件包版本并没有变化。

不知道现在是不是还是这么干的......如果还是这种更新方式,还不如下载 deb 手动安装更新了......

Reply View the author
Tonny
deepin
2024-11-19 11:50
#4
It has been deleted!
神末shenmo
deepin
Spark-App
2024-11-19 13:01
#5

这个更新不走包管理的,是QQ在你的用户目录下面拉屎,相比说是更新不如说是QQ同时保留了旧版和新版


不建议用这种方法更新,最终结果就是电脑里有新旧两个QQ,你还没法清理

像UOS这样权限管理严格的系统都不允许运行这种热更新的产物

Reply View the author
mozixun
deepin
2024-11-19 13:17
#6
神末shenmo

这个更新不走包管理的,是QQ在你的用户目录下面拉屎,相比说是更新不如说是QQ同时保留了旧版和新版


不建议用这种方法更新,最终结果就是电脑里有新旧两个QQ,你还没法清理

像UOS这样权限管理严格的系统都不允许运行这种热更新的产物

可以用玲珑版,直接强制/只读抹掉这个功能

Reply View the author
Haydn
deepin
2024-11-19 15:37
#7
Tonny It has been deleted!

这不是挺好的嘛

Reply View the author
随机数
deepin
2024-11-19 16:57
#8
Haydn

这不是挺好的嘛

坑就坑在,更新它不是基于现有的应用的安装目录「应用商店安装默认:/opt/apps/linux.qq.com/」更新,而是默认在用户的home目录下搞一个「~/.config/QQ/versions/3.2.13-29725」。

Reply View the author
随机数
deepin
2024-11-19 17:02
#9
神末shenmo

这个更新不走包管理的,是QQ在你的用户目录下面拉屎,相比说是更新不如说是QQ同时保留了旧版和新版


不建议用这种方法更新,最终结果就是电脑里有新旧两个QQ,你还没法清理

像UOS这样权限管理严格的系统都不允许运行这种热更新的产物

奈何?假设后续QQ强制走应用内更新,不更新频繁弹提示,而应用商店又没有及时更新,如之奈何?

Reply View the author
神末shenmo
deepin
Spark-App
2024-11-19 17:12
#10
随机数

奈何?假设后续QQ强制走应用内更新,不更新频繁弹提示,而应用商店又没有及时更新,如之奈何?

https://spk-resolv.spark-app.store/?spk=spk://store/chat/linuxqq

我们更新比官方都快(跟测试频道,比官方正式版都快)

Reply View the author
hinata
deepin
2024-11-20 04:35
#11

暂时没有发现

Reply View the author